How does gonorrhea start in females?

The main ways people get gonorrhea are from having vaginal sex, anal sex, or oral sex. You can also get gonorrhea by touching your eye if you have infected fluids on your hand. Gonorrhea can also be spread to a baby during birth if the mother has it.

What can be mistaken for gonorrhea?

Gonorrhea symptoms in women are usually mild and can be easily mistaken for a UTI or vaginal infection….They can include:

  • Pain or burning when you pee.
  • The urge to pee more than usual.
  • Unusual vaginal discharge.
  • Vaginal bleeding between periods.
  • Painful sex.
  • Pain in your belly.
  • A fever.

How long can a woman have gonorrhea without knowing?

Symptoms. It is fairly common for gonorrhea to cause no symptoms, especially in women. The incubation period, the time from exposure to the bacteria until symptoms develop, is usually 2 to 5 days. But sometimes symptoms may not develop for up to 30 days.

Does gonorrhea smell fishy?

STDs and “Fishy Odors” Several common STDs like chlamydia and gonorrhea can cause discharge from the genitals. Occasionally, this discharge may have a pungent smell associated with it, but more often than not, this isn’t the case.

How does gonorrhea discharge look like?

Gonorrhea and vaginal discharges And also like chlamydia, gonorrhea discharges are frequently filled with mucus and pus—and commonly has a cloudy appearance—and can range from white to yellow to green in color.
